Transaction 327f2ed07f31a8539698bf209c515e6d8a5981a4dc1d1952138fb5819908e078

18 Input
2 Outputs
  • 327f2ed07f31a8539698bf209c515e6d8a5981a4dc1d1952138fb5819908e078:0
  • value  965772
    address  31zUXzEkHm5jA1WfrDPQs7ifNo4qxzpRCa
  • 327f2ed07f31a8539698bf209c515e6d8a5981a4dc1d1952138fb5819908e078:1
  • value  105014777
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s